Caravan Chicken
This recipe evolves each time it is cooked because it depends on what is in the pantry.
Chicken thigh pieces diced into bite sized chunks.
Marinade – A good slurp of whatever sauces are available:
Sweet Chilli Sauce
Sriracha Hot Chilli Sauce
Soy Sauce
Ketjap Manis (thick sweet Indonesian soy)
Marinate the chicken in an airtight container for a few hours, then toss on a hot BBQ. Delicious with anything and must be eaten outdoors to enhance the experience.
